Alkud (M) - Kavathemahankal, Sangli
Alkud (M) is a village situated in the Kavathemahankal tehsil of Sangli district, Maharashtra. It is located approximately 15 km from the tehsil headquarters in Kavathemahankal and around 27 km from the district headquarters in Sangli. Alkud M serves as the Gram Panchayat for Alkud (M) village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Alkud (M) is 568806. The village covers a total geographical area of 945 hectares and falls under the 416419 pincode. Sangli Miraj Kupwad is the nearest town, located about 27 km away.
Alkud (M) village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Khanapur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Sangli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Alkud (M)
As per Census 2011, Alkud (M) village has a total population of 1,309 people, consisting of 681 males and 628 females. The village has 274 households and a sex ratio of 922 females per 1,000 males. There are 139 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 996 literate and 313 illiterate residents. Additionally, 159 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.
Detailed gender-wise population figures for Alkud (M) are given below:
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 1,309 | 681 | 628 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 139 | 79 | 60 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 159 | 87 | 72 |
| Literate Population | 996 | 558 | 438 |
| Illiterate Population | 313 | 123 | 190 |

Transport and Connectivity of Alkud (M)
Alkud (M) is connected by an all-weather road, while public transport facilities are available within <1 km of the village.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within >10 km |
| Railway Station | No | - |

Banking and Postal Services in Alkud (M)
Banking and postal services are essential for daily financial transactions and communication. The availability of these facilities for Alkud (M) village is detailed below:
| Service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Bank |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| ATM |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Post Office | Yes | Available within village |
Health Facilities in Alkud (M)
Healthcare facilities play an important role in providing basic medical services to the residents. The details regarding the nearest health centres and hospitals serving Alkud (M) village are given below:
| Facility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Health Sub-Centre (HSC) |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Primary Health Centre (PHC) | No | Available within >10 km |
| Community Health Centre (CHC) | No | Available within >10 km |
